Siemens Intrunet E-Line intruder detector designed to cut installation time by up to 50 percent
The range includes single and dual technology detectors, combining cost-effective detection technologies with smart functionality and unmatched installation flexibility. All models are available with or without an antimask functionality, and have built-in adjustable sensitivity for microwave and PIR.
Ideal for a wide range of standard applications and environments, the Intrunet™ E-Line detectors were designed with the installer in mind. All detectors offer the same popular features found in other Intrunet™ detectors, such as the “snap-in” enclosure, but they also deliver new levels of installation flexibility and speed.
Everything in the E-Line detector range was designed to facilitate and shorten installation by over 50%, such as:
• Plug-in EoL boards for 2-wire installations and with pre-set resistor values selectable via switches
• Clever “clip-on/-off” terminal block simplifies the wiring and holds all wires tightly in place
• Unique two-piece “snap-in” enclosure:
– no contamination of optics or electronics during installation
– easy upgrade of detectors
One of the key features in E-Line detectors is the unique End of Line (EoL) concept, which reduces the preparation time, eliminates time consuming manual resistor wiring, reduces the risk of wiring errors and facilitates installation troubleshooting. A major advantage is that all detectors are pet immune up to 12 kg (plus switchable up to 30 kg), therefore eliminating the for a separate pet immune portfolio.
This smart and unique concept dramatically reduces the complexity of wiring inside the detector. This reduces the risk of cabling errors and makes fault finding much quicker.
The E-Line detectors constitute the first complete detector family certified to EN 50131-2-2:2008 and EN 50131-2-4:2008, meeting 100% of all required tests – an achievement supported by independent test reports.
